Artistic parquet production

In order to make artistic parquet, craftsmen use cherry, maple, alder, birch, oak, elm and other tree species. For expensive and more festive parquet, exotic types of trees can be used - sapieha, dussia, iroko, campas.

Parquet can have absolutely any pattern and color. Previously, palace parquet was made by hand. Now the drawing is made on a computer, and all the details are cut out using lasers. This allows you to create any drawing absolutely accurate in terms of composition. Laser technologies help to carve the most openwork ornament, while all the details fit perfectly together, which ensures the parquet for many years of service.

Drawing technology

Depending on what technique the drawing was applied, they distinguish different kinds parquet:

  • Marketi. Is one of the most popular. All elements of the ornament are inside the cover and form a common whole. To date, this technology is most often used in the creation of artistic parquet.
  • Intarsia. Drawings of artistic parquet in the technique of intarsia differ from the market in that they go inside the coating to a certain depth.
  • Inlay. The most refined, festive and expensive type of parquet pattern. Masters, in addition to rare species of trees, use metal and stones - amber, onyx, jade. This floor looks just like a king. The manufacture of inlaid parquet requires high skill and precision from the manufacturer. The main disadvantage of parquet for the buyer is its high price.
  • Count. An ancient way of making parquet, which was used many centuries ago. Today it is not used, since the technology was lost.

Elements of artistic parquet

The choice of ornament and pattern for parquet is quite difficult. There are basic types of floor design that can turn parquet into a real work of art.

  • Border. It performs several important functions at once. It allows you to divide the space into several functional zones. With it, you can separate the borders of drawings of different styles. It beautifully frames the floor and brings completeness to the whole composition. The border can be either one-color or repeat any of the elements of the ornament. Most often, plant motifs or silhouettes of animals are used. The border can exist separately or in alliance with the outlet. In any case, it is designed to frame the entire composition and help with the layout of the rooms.
  • Socket. The most popular design element of parquet flooring. An oval or round socket is located in the center of the room. The only exception is when the socket becomes key elements any area in the room.

The rosette pattern may or may not be symmetrical. A true craftsman can create a true masterpiece when working with a rosette design. The size and borders of the outlets can be any.

The socket can be enclosed in a circle or oval, or the borders can be left open. Patterns from its center can blur over the entire area of ​​​​the parquet. In the manufacture of this artistic element, use various breeds tree - on average, two to ten species are required. Often the socket is inlaid with stones and metal to give a special luxury to the room.

  • Modules. They have the shape of a square, they can consist of one or two types of wood. Modular parquet has an identical pattern on every detail. Most often, geometric patterns are made up of modules. The result is a complete picture. Assembling such a modular mosaic takes much less time than laying out an ornament from different parts.

Care rules

Art parquet is natural material having various characteristics depending on the type of wood used. However, all types of wood have common features. Parquet reacts to humidity: when it is wet, it can expand in size, and when it is dry, it can shrink. That is why in winter, during the heating season, parquet elements can shrink, then small cracks appear between them.

It should be understood that this is not evidence of the poor quality of the parquet, it is only a sign of its naturalness. Artistic parquet laminate can behave in the same way. In order to prevent cracks from appearing in the floor, a normal humidity level should be maintained in the room - from 45% to 60%. This will favorably affect not only the floor covering, but also the health of the household.

There are three types of material, each of which differs in appearance:

  • Single-strip lumber in appearance resembles a massive board.
  • Two-strip parquet has a pronounced embossed texture.
  • A three-lane board is similar in appearance to parquet.

Regardless of the type, the material is made from three layers:

  • The first layer is four millimeters thick. It is made from expensive wood species, which are subjected to special processing, which gives the board high aesthetic qualities.
  • The second layer is 10 mm. It is created from rack blanks fastened together by a lock connection. Reiki - wood needles or larch.
  • The third layer is the base. Its thickness is 1.5 mm. This layer is made from coniferous wood blanks.


Layers of parquet boards are glued together. The top layer is varnished or a special oil coating. However, the lacquer coating has a long service life and external attractiveness to a greater extent.

Flaws

The parquet board in the interior of the apartment looks great. However, despite all positive traits, the material has its drawbacks, which buyers should be aware of. Although parquet is resistant to fluctuations in humidity and temperature in the room, it does not tolerate large amounts of water. When wet, the material swells and deforms.


In addition, the top layer of parquet lumber is soft coating. Therefore, it is recommended to place strips of chipboard under furniture legs to reduce pressure and avoid dents in the flooring.


It should be noted that parquet wood has high cost, which can also be considered a disadvantage for many buyers.

The role of parquet in the interior

The floor, as the basis of the room, sets the tone for the design of the entire room. And parquet as a floor covering, not only creates a beautiful decorative effect, but is also an environmentally friendly, practical and durable flooring. With it, you can change the perception of the room as a whole. So wide planks visually expand the space, making it more voluminous. And narrow stripes give the room coziness and compactness.

Photo of parquet in the interior - the use of narrow and wide planks

An important role in the design of the room is played by the flooring pattern. The most popular styling method is herringbone. Such a pattern is quite laborious in execution, but, due to the special arrangement of the slats, it will last a very long time.

Herringbone flooring never goes out of style

In the minimalist design of the room, you can use the laying of boards in a "deck" way. At the same time, the plates are placed in parallel, imitating the continuity of the boards, which was previously used in shipbuilding.

On a note: this option of laying parquet is the most economical in terms of material consumption.

"Deck" parquet is an excellent base for accenting furniture, decor elements

There are other ways of laying dice, with which you can diversify the design of the room. These are “squares”, “chess”, diagonal, “braid”, in a run - the scope for imagination is unlimited.

Please note: the more varied and complex the flooring pattern, the more skill will be required to implement it.
